Snapchat Launchers Web Page Design

Snapchat Launchers is a single product-review page composed around the story of Snapchat Spectacles V2. The layout begins with a large lifestyle image and turquoise text panel, then shifts to an overlaid editorial card, a three-part specifications area, and three split sections. These sections balance product imagery with discussions of water resistance, outdoor use, charging, Bluetooth phone syncing, HD export, and the smaller charging case. Bold black typography, yellow emphasis, vertical lines, generous white space, and repeated Read more actions create a high-contrast magazine composition.

Image-Led Transitions Separate Each Spectacles V2 Story Beat

The page’s composition depends on changes in scale, alignment, and density as much as on the written content. The opening hero places a large lifestyle image beside a contrasting turquoise text panel, allowing the headline and summary to command the first view. The next section reverses the relationship by placing a compact white editorial card over a background image, creating a tighter visual pause before the specification discussion.

The Thirds block introduces a more ordered rhythm: a bold yellow heading panel sits next to two text columns about availability and build quality. The later Split sections return to an image-and-copy balance, but each uses a different relationship. Outdoor and product images surround the water-resistance discussion, while the phone image in the charging section gives the Bluetooth syncing and HD export explanation a concrete visual counterweight. The final yellow copy area beside the product image acts as a closing compositional anchor.

These transitions keep a long article from becoming a uniform stack of text. White cards isolate short assessments, wide imagery supplies visual pauses, and repeated Read more links create consistent action points without overpowering the editorial hierarchy. The design therefore works as a carefully arranged individual web page whose meaning comes from placement, contrast, and progression between sections.
